Handing off the Quillbus broker upgrade (4.x to 5.1) to Dario. Cluster is half-migrated; mixed-version mode is supported but TLS cert rotation must finish before cutover. No auth model changes, though the admin API gained two new endpoints worth reviewing. Open questions and the migration checklist are tracked on the internal page below.

dashboard of taduf-bawef = https://jira.lumicsys.internal/projects/display/browse/b1cbf89d

## Runbook: Migrating off Forgewheel Queue

We are replacing the homegrown Forgewheel queue with Pellcart, our managed broker. New consumers should register through the Pellcart adapter rather than polling the legacy table. Drain old workers before cutover, then flip the MIGRATION_MODE flag to dual-write. The adapter needs a broker credential in your local env file, so append this line next.

vault entry, kagep-yajeg: COURIER_KEY5=da097

## Bump defaults in fixturesmith factories

Heads-up for the sync: this tidies up our fixturesmith test-data library so generated orders stop colliding on unique fields when suites run in parallel. Main change is seeding per-worker ranges instead of one global counter. Should kill the flaky Tuesday failures in the Brackenfold suite. I also retuned the generation knobs, listed here.

tuning table, fawip-fahag:
WEIGHTS = {
    "novwyn": 452,
    "casdor": 675,
}